The Ultimate Supergroup Playlist
We’ve always been fascinated by the idea of “supergroups,” those iconic (or dubious) combinations of members of different bands forming like Voltron into one giant, powerful group. It inspired us to create this Supergroup Playlist, which compiles more than 45 years worth of all-star bands.
Some you’ll definitely recognize, like Cream (considered the first supergroup) and SlaughtaHouse. Others are more obscure, like LSG (an R&B powerhouse of Gerald Levert, Keith Sweat and Johnny Gill) and Class of ’99 (a combo of Alice in Chains singer Layne Staley, Rage Against the Machine guitarist Tom Morello, Jane’s Addiction drummer Stephen Perkins and Porno for Pyros bassist Martyn LeNoble that recorded just one song).
